## Welcome to Feedwright On-Call

Feedwright checks partner podcast feeds every 15 minutes. Most alerts are upstream feed typos — validate manually before panicking. The dashboard lives in the `ops` workspace; creds are in the vault. If a partner feed stays broken past two cycles, escalate rather than patching it yourself. Questions during your first week? Just email us.

escalation mailbox, bafog-fafog: ulador@paliqlabs.internal

- [ ] **Step 7: Breaker override escrow.** After sealing the signing keys for the Tallgrove upstream API circuit breaker, confirm the support team can force the breaker open during a full outage. The override bundle lives in the sealed escrow drawer and is useless without its unlock phrase. Two ceremony witnesses must initial this step before proceeding. The escrow bundle is decrypted with the recovery passphrase that follows.

vault phrase of kahip-kahop = holath-quenmir

**Migration step 4: Repoint the ChronoGate reader service**

After verifying that all timing-chip readers along the Harborline Marathon course have flushed their buffered reads, stop the legacy ingest daemon on each gateway. Do not restart it. Install the new `chronogate-reader` package, confirm the checksum, and carefully review the split-time dedup settings before enabling ingestion. The service writes chip reads to the results database via the connection string below.

replica DSN, kajep-yahag: mssql://praok_svc:iF@db-8d68.plorvaio.local:5432/eliion